I know I always have very limited packing space so don’t overpack either, not everything on this list is necessary for everyone, some things are just there to remind you not to forget them if they are something you would normally bring! Number of items may vary as well depending on how long your trip may be!
Let’s start with the basics..wherever you are going you will most defiantly need:
-All things to do with Teeth! {Toothbrush, toothpaste, retainers, whitening strips, mouthwash, floss, etc..}
–Deodorant
-ALL the appropriate Bras for clothes you are packing {everyday, strapless, push-up, backless, & sports}: I absolutely hate it when I bring something backless but cannot wear it because I have forgotten my backless bra!
–Underwear
–Hair Products: {Hairspray, Shampoo, Conditioner, all your styling products}
–Hair Straightener, Hair Dryer, and Hair Curler
–Contacts & Glasses
–Chargers for ALL your devices with your names on them!! Often when traveling with other families, I can’t be the only one who gets mine mixed up with friends or even other family members
–Hair clips, hair ties, & headbands
–Traveling Essentials! {A good book, magazines, a pillow, some headphones, puzzles..things to keep you busy on the way there!}
–Sunblock! You don’t want to come back looking like a tomato or not be able to enjoy your getaway because of a burn! My favorite sunblock is SunBum because I find it to not feel “sticky” on my skin and it smells amazing!
